Abstract

The utility model provides a belt weigher online adjusting device that rectifies, the adjusting device symmetry is installed in the both sides of the trailing axle of belt weigher bearing, its characterized in that, each belt weigher online adjusting device that rectifies includes: a fixed plate, it is fixed on the belt weigher frame, a reduction gear, for a worm gear speed reducer ware, the worm gear speed reducer ware is fixed in on the fixed plate, the output shaft and an adjusting bolt of reduction gear are connected, adjusting bolt is connected with belt weigher driven pulley bearing frame, a handle, with the input shaft of reduction gear just causes in the casing the dismantled outside of belt weigher.

Belt conveyer scale correction on-line tuning device
Technical field
This utility model is related to a kind of belt conveyer scale correction on-line tuning device.
Background technology
The belt conveyer scale S-6211 of theoretical density one device additive system is that the resin powder of extruder feeds scale, is pelletize system System one of key equipment of stable operation at full capacity.Equipment is by Singapore of additive system contractor Compass (Compaq this) Over contract, French Hasler (Haas Le) manufacture.Equipment signs technical protocol in December, 2004, and device fabrication in 2005 is complete Become.On May 24th, 2012 proceeds by strip debugging, finds that belt has sideslip situation, adjusted by producer in debugging process, Sideslip scope can be adjusted.August in 2012 device on the 23rd goes into operation in commissioning process because belt conveyer scale sideslip causes pelletize to join Locking car, produces chain for belt deviation cancellation, 24 hours monitoring adjustment belts of maintainer for maintaining.Belt conveyer scale adjusts process In per half an hour need to carry out patrolling and examining once, adjustment once takes 3-4 hour, cannot meet steady production requirement at all.For solution This problem of determining is special to set up tackling key problem group.
Utility model content
The purpose of this utility model is to provide a kind of belt conveyer scale correction on-line tuning device, which solves belt and runs Partially problem, is just to complete correction in the case of shutdownvoltage to adjust it is ensured that equipment long-term operation.
In order to achieve the above object, this utility model provides a kind of belt conveyer scale correction on-line tuning device, and this adjustment fills Put the both sides of the follower shaft bearing being symmetrically arranged on belt conveyer scale, each described adjusting apparatus include:
One fixed plate, it is fixed on belt conveyer scale framework;
One speed reducer, is a worm type of reduction gearing, and described worm type of reduction gearing is fixed in described fixed plate, described The output shaft of decelerator is connected with a regulating bolt, and described regulating bolt is connected with belt conveyer scale follower belt wheel bearing seat;
One handle, is connected and causes the detachable hull outside in belt conveyer scale with the input shaft of described decelerator.
Described belt conveyer scale correction on-line tuning device, also includes one speed reducer bracket assembly, one end and described decelerator It is connected, the other end is connected with the detachable housing of belt conveyer scale.
Above-mentioned belt conveyer scale correction on-line tuning device, described reducer stent assembly is an installation panel, which is provided with One spacing hole, multiple second installing hole, the input of described decelerator is connected through described spacing hole with described handle, described peace Dress panel is fixed on the medial surface of detachable housing of belt conveyer scale through described second installing hole using securing member.
Above-mentioned belt conveyer scale correction on-line tuning device, described spacing hole is arranged at the centre of described plate, described spacing Kong Weiyi shoulder hole.
Above-mentioned belt conveyer scale correction on-line tuning device, the output shaft of described decelerator is also connected with an adapter sleeve, described defeated Shaft is connected with described regulating bolt by described adapter sleeve
Above-mentioned belt conveyer scale correction on-line tuning device, the both ends of described adapter sleeve are respectively provided with one first installing hole, institute State output shaft, regulating bolt to be connected with adapter sleeve two ends by described first installing hole respectively.
Above-mentioned belt conveyer scale correction on-line tuning device, the detachable housing of belt conveyer scale is provided with an observation window.
This utility model compared with prior art has an advantageous effect in that:
When device is mainly used in belt transmission sideslip, rectified a deviation in the case of not parking, be finely adjusted manually online, kept away Exempt to cause device to stop it is ensured that appliance arrangement even running due to belt deviation.
On-line tuning device is increased on equipment, increases watch window in housing simultaneously, be easy to be seen during belt adjustment Examine.Mounting and adjusting decelerator on the driven bearing housing of belt conveyer scale, decelerator is made up of worm gear, worm screw, and adjustment handle is led to Claim external, when making belt conveyer scale possess operation, constantly observation, the condition constantly adjusting.

Specific embodiment
With specific embodiment, technical solutions of the utility model are described in detail below in conjunction with the accompanying drawings, with further Understand the purpose of this utility model, scheme and effect, but be not limited to this utility model.
The belt conveyer scale correction on-line tuning device that this utility model provides, is symmetrically arranged on the follower shaft bearing of belt conveyer scale The both sides of A, as shown in Figure 1 and Figure 2, each belt conveyer scale correction on-line tuning device includes:
One fixed plate 1, it is fixed on belt conveyer scale framework;
One speed reducer 2, is a worm type of reduction gearing, and worm type of reduction gearing is fixed in fixed plate 1, decelerator 2 Output shaft is connected with a regulating bolt 22, and regulating bolt 22 is connected with belt conveyer scale follower belt wheel bearing seat;Enter one to say, slow down The output shaft of device is also connected with an adapter sleeve 23, and the both ends of adapter sleeve 23 are respectively provided with one and supply output shaft 21, regulating bolt 22 to connect The first installing hole.
One handle 3, is connected with the input shaft of decelerator 2 and causes outside the detachable housing (not shown) of belt conveyer scale;
One speed reducer bracket assembly 4, one end is connected with decelerator 2, and the other end is connected with the detachable housing of belt conveyer scale Connect, in detail it, reducer stent assembly 4 be one installation panel, which is provided with a spacing hole, multiple second installing hole, decelerator 2 Input be connected through spacing hole with handle 3, install panel be fixed on belt conveyer scale using securing member through the second installing hole On the medial surface of detachable housing.
During actual installation, first fixed plate 1 is fixed on belt conveyer scale framework, then fixing for decelerator 2 in this fixed plate 1 On.Decelerator 2 selects 1:50 worm type of reduction gearings that is to say, that when worm screw turns 50 circle, worm gear turns around, decelerator defeated Shaft 21 is connected with regulating bolt 22, model M20 × 2 of regulating bolt 22, regulating bolt 22 and belt conveyer scale follower belt wheel shaft Connect in bearing, when worm screw rotates a circle, regulating bolt 22 drives the tight or loose 0.04mm of bearing block it is achieved that the adjustment of belt Effect.Because worm and gear has auto-lock function, after having adjusted, just energy self-locking, meets adjustment requirement.
According to decelerator rotating ratio, calculate handle 3 and rotate a circle, driven pulley advances or retreats 0.04mm, so Just know tension on belt, in equipment operation, when belt deviation, observed belt deviation situation in observation window, entered with handss Row turning handle 3 is adjusted, till belt operates in prescribed limit.
Increase on-line tuning device, increase watch window in detachable housing simultaneously, be easy to belt adjustment.In tightening roller one Increased turbine, worm structure on the jackscrew of end, adjustment handle is led to that title is external, when making belt conveyer scale possess operation, constantly sees The condition examine, constantly adjusting.
Using the device of this new offer, obtain very big direct economic benefit and indirect economic effect;Direct economy is imitated Benefit:Transformation is passed through in workshop, it is to avoid and good fortune refine the same equipment is directly eliminated, directly retrieve economic losses 3,600,000 yuan.Due to skin Belt scale sideslip high yield cannot normally be run, and be only capable of running below 30 ton hour yields, operate steadily after transformation, Ke Yibao Card granulating system 37 ton hour is run, and granulating system yield improves 7 tons per hour.Year goes into operation at full capacity 100 days and calculates, yield Improve 16800 tons, 500 yuan of benefit of increase per ton, year economic benefit be 8,400,000 yuan, reduce because the equipment pelletize that causes of operation Stop and calculate according to 10 times/year, stop every time and produce big 2 tons of block (5900 yuan/ton), 10 tons of driving waste material (10500 yuan/ Ton), 11000 yuan/ton of certified products, (11000-10500) × 10 × 10+ (11000-5900) × ten thousand yuan of 2 × 10=15.2, every year Can 15.2 ten thousand yuan of potentiation due to reducing parking.Reduce because equipment runs the pelletize parking causing and calculates according to 10 times/year, every time Parking is adjusted needing 4 hours about.37 tons of production per hour, 500 yuan of benefit per ton, then every year produce product potentiation more: Ten thousand yuan of 37 × 10 × 4 × 500=74.Therefore indirect economic effect 840+15.2+74=929.2 ten thousand yuan/year.
